I recently got hacked and am in the process of recovering my account and regaining at least a fraction of my previous wealth, but I'm still worried. Even after recovering it, they hacker STILL knows the answer to my secret question (thats how he hacked me in the first place, i got key logged). So unless I change my secret question, he can just do it again. Blizzard hasn't addressed this, how can I change my secret question?

I'd be really interested if anyone knew an answer to this as well...this happened to my friend and he has been hacked by (presumably) the same person 4 times. After the last time, they emailed him a new password which he copied and pasted every time he logged in...to avoid keyloggers. He just got hacked again today and upon calling Blizzard was informed that someone had called to change the password only an hour earlier. He's able to do this because he has the answer to the secret question but Blizzard refuses to help him with this. Is there any way around it?

I believe this is something that can only be sorted out with a Blizzard representative. It would be a good idea to have every bit of personal information at the ready, including the key used to create the account. It isn't their usual policy to ask for account keys, but neither it is usual for the secret question to be comprimised.

I know you said a key logger got your secret question information, but what required you to type it in so that he could get it in the first place?

I haven't heard of an instance where the secret question has been changed sadly.
